I made some additional tests. There is a strange interaction between format and metadata (including GPS data but not limited to them)
1) I initially though that there was a specific issue with JXL files for "clean metadada" which is not available (greyed) for such files, but I have just noticed that it is also not available for TIF and PNG (works fine for JPG; I did not test for other formats)
2) If the JXL file is generated (batch convert) from a non-geotagged (but with some other exif metadada) TIF or PNG file with "preserve metadata', it is then indeed possible to add geolocation later to the JXL file. In contrast, if the JXL file was generated with "preserve metadata" unchecked, geotagging becomes impossible (but seems possible: values can be entered, one can click on "write", but nothing is written)

About 'clean metadata', I have just noticed that there is 2 locations for that, in the browser and in the viewer. The browser one is not available for TIF, PNG and JXL, but available for JPG, where cleaning is done losslessly. The viewer one is available for all these formats (including JXL) and does the work, even if there is no metadata to clean, and involves re-compressing the file to save it, which is problematic for lossy format such as JPG and JXL. At least for JPG there is the browser's clean that can be used losslessly, but not for JXL
About geolocation,, i attach a JXL file generated by batch-convert of XnViewMP from a TIF file with "preserve metadata" unchecked. No means on my side to add lon, lat or altitude values to this file using "edit GPS data"

The specific issue of writing geolocation data in the metadata of a jxl file has been solved in 1.9. Thanks.
Remains the issue of removing metadata using "clean" in the browser mode. It works for jpg files but does not work for jxl, png and tif files (and may be some other formats I did not test)
